What is distance=12mi;time=2h;rate

Mathematics
1 answer:
liberstina [14]3 years ago
6 0
Distance=speed time time
distance/time=speed
12mi/2hr=6mi/1hr=6mph=rate

what is the area of a circle with a diameter of 4.2 centimeters? us 3.14 for pi. round your answer to the nearest tenth.
emmainna [20.7K]
Circle Area = PI * radius^2
radius = 2.1
Circle Area = 3.14 * 2.1^2
Circle Area = <span> <span> <span> 13.8
